Brumado Facts
| Area | 27.8 km² |
| Population | 45,895 |
| Male Population | 22,068 (48.1%) |
| Female Population | 23,827 (51.9%) |
| Population change (1975 to 2020) | +51.3% |
| Population change (2000 to 2020) | +5.6% |
| Median Age | 29.6 years (Male: 29, Female: 30.3) |
| GDP per capita (PPP) | $8,185 (2022) |
| Neighborhoods | Centro, Novo Brumado, Flores, Mercado, Jardim Brasil |
| Local Time | |
| Timezone | Brasilia Standard Time |
| Lat & Lng | -14.20361, -41.66528 |
| Postal Codes | 46100 |

Brumado Population
Years 1975 to 2030
| Data | 1975 | 1990 | 2000 | 2015 | 2020 | 2025* | 2030* |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 30,333 | 39,402 | 43,456 | 46,010 | 45,895 | 45,958 | 46,268 |
| Population Density | 1,090.6 / km² | 1,416.7 / km² | 1,562.5 / km² | 1,654.3 / km² | 1,650.2 / km² | 1,652.4 / km² | 1,663.6 / km² |
Brumado Population change from 2000 to 2020
Increase of 5.6% from year 2000 to 2020
| Location | Change since 1975 | Change since 1990 | Change since 2000 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brumado | +51.3% | +16.5% | +5.6% |
| Bahia | — | — | — |
| Brazil | — | — | — |
Brumado Median Age
Median Age: 29.6 years
| Location | Median Age | Median Age (Female) | Median Age (Male)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brumado | 29.6 yrs | 30.3 yrs | 29 yrs |
| Bahia | 28 yrs | 28.7 yrs | 27.3 yrs |
| Brazil | 29.5 yrs | 30.3 yrs | 28.7 yrs |
Brumado Population Density
Population Density: 1,650 / km²
| Location | Population | Area | Density |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brumado | 45,895 | 27.8 km² | 1,650 / km² |
| Bahia | 14.9 million | 564,733.3 km² | 26.4 / km² |
| Brazil | 206.1 million | 8,479,487.1 km² | 24.3 / km² |

Brumado Gross Domestic Product (GDP)
GDP per capita, PPP (constant 2017 international $)
| Data | 1990 | 1995 | 2000 | 2005 | 2010 | 2015 | 2020 | 2022 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| GDP per capita | $4,721 | $5,462 | $6,198 | $8,269 | $9,147 | $8,549 | $7,220 | $8,185 |
| Total GDP | $141.4M | $170M | $197.8M | $273.7M | $304.9M | $285.6M | $245.2M | $278.1M |
Brumado CO2 Emissions
Carbon Dioxide (CO2) Emissions Per Capita in Tonnes Per Year
| Location | CO2 Emissions | CO2 Emissions Per Capita | CO2 Emissions Intensity |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brumado | 119,776 tn | 2.61 tn | 4,306.6 tons/km² |
| Bahia | 34,390,751 tn | 2.31 tn | 60.9 tons/km² |
| Brazil | 561,829,904 tn | 2.73 tn | 66.3 tons/km² |
| 2013 CO2 emissions (tonnes/year) | 119,776 tn |
| 2013 CO2 emissions (tonnes/year) per capita | 2.61 tn |
| 2013 CO2 emissions intensity (tonnes/km²/year) | 4,306.6 tons/km² |
